All Volunteer divers must be able to meet the minimum standards of our American Academy of Underwater Sciences compliant program. Including a swim & dive test, full dive physical w/chest x-ray.

The diver is responsible for the assoicated costs of the physical which may be completed by a Medical Doctor of there choice (no PA’s pleaseand may be asked to cover some costs for advanced training & certifications. These fees are only for the recovery of operational expenses for training media, generation of certification cards from both PADI & AAUS, AAUS individual membership fees, and dive trips/training that happen offsite (boat fees, housing and or food costs on catalina or elsewhere).

The funds requested are not for profit and you are not paying for instruction.

Please do not get physical until you have gone thru intial orientation that describes volunteer diver roles in a public aquarium environment and the continued commitment that is involved.

After successful completion of entire course and assoicated required dives, you will be a member of the California Science Center Dive Team Member, a PADI rescue diver with at least one specialty (probably nitrox), certified AAUS Scientific Diver, and an individual member of the American Academy of Underwater Sciences.
